What are my legal obligations to my neighbor when building a fence in California?
California Civil Code 841 requires written notification to all adjoining property owners at least 30 days before constructing or replacing a shared boundary fence. How do Banning's soil and pest conditions affect material choice?
Moderate soil corrosivity and termite risk dictate specific material compatibility. Pressure-treated lumber must be rated for ground contact. Use hot-dip galvanized or stainless steel fasteners to prevent rust streaks from reacting with the soil. Composite or metal posts are superior for longevity in these conditions compared to untreated wood.

What is required before digging fence post holes?
State law requires contacting DigAlert (811) at least two working days before excavation. In Downtown Banning, hitting a gas or communication line is a major financial and safety liability.
